Understanding Dreams

Dreaming about your deceased sister can trigger deep emotions and reflection. These dreams often serve as a bridge to process feelings of loss and nostalgia.

Common Themes in Dreams

  1. Visitation: Dreams may feel like your sister is visiting. This experience can provide comfort and a sense of connection.
  2. Messages: You might interpret her appearance as a message. For instance, she could symbolize unresolved feelings or offer reassurance.
  3. Emotional Release: These dreams might reflect your grief. A dream may bring tears or laughter, allowing you to express emotions you might suppress during waking hours.

Possible Interpretations

  • Grief Processing: Dreams often reflect your emotional state. Dreaming of your sister may symbolize the ongoing journey of grieving and healing.
  • Life Changes: If you’re facing significant life changes, her appearance could signify support through difficult transitions.
  • Memories: Dreams can trigger vivid memories of shared experiences. They might bring back fond moments that offer solace.

Tips for Understanding Your Dreams

  1. Keep a Dream Journal: Write down your dreams, focusing on feelings and symbols. This practice helps identify patterns and themes.
  2. Reflect on Your Emotions: Consider how the dream relates to your current life. Reflecting on feelings can uncover hidden messages.
  3. Discuss with Others: Sharing your dreams with friends or family can provide new insights. They might help you see connections you hadn’t noticed.

Cultural Views on Dreaming of the Dead

Various cultures interpret dreams about deceased loved ones, including sisters, in unique ways. These interpretations often revolve around themes of grief, connection, and spiritual messages.

Western Perspectives

In many Western cultures, dreaming of a deceased sister often symbolizes unresolved feelings. You might perceive these dreams as your mind processing grief or a longing for connection. Psychologists suggest these dreams can signal the need for closure or remind you of shared experiences.

Eastern Traditions

Eastern cultures, such as those in some Asian countries, view dreams of the dead as significant spiritual messages. You may interpret these dreams as a sign that your sister is attempting to communicate from the beyond. They often represent comfort, wisdom, or guidance during difficult times.

Indigenous Beliefs

Many Indigenous cultures see dreams involving the dead as a bridge between two worlds. You might find that these dreams allow you to connect with your sister’s spirit. This connection can provide support and reassurance as you navigate life’s challenges.

Religious Views

Religious interpretations also influence how you view these dreams. In some faiths, dreams of deceased loved ones signify blessings or divine messages. You may interpret your sister’s appearance in a dream as encouragement or guidance during uncertain moments.

Common Threads Across Cultures

Despite differing beliefs, several common themes emerge across cultures. Dreams about deceased sisters can represent comfort, unresolved emotions, or guidance. You might recognize these threads and draw meaning from them to help navigate your feelings and foster emotional healing.
